Transaction 1271278af843929b08d1299b6bee820e8ad78bcbfb989bfd3ff03ae679ee3b21
1 Input
2 Outputs
- 1271278af843929b08d1299b6bee820e8ad78bcbfb989bfd3ff03ae679ee3b21:0
- 1271278af843929b08d1299b6bee820e8ad78bcbfb989bfd3ff03ae679ee3b21:1
value 16846767
address 1CQBF8LXP7T1AuyqCKH5LS4CHKkPgvPNXa
value 3883143233
address 152odxg2icTaUiWzXZRt5PuBqrTS1tJRw5